I searched but it seems as tho know one has solved the fiav or tps difference. It seems as tho everyone just blocks these off and dont use the isc either. Can some one tell me if it'll be ok to not use the fiav and tell me how to wire up the tps?
 
Here's a few links regarding the swap. Usually when you get a 91-up TB the lower half comes with it, that's why you haven't heard anything. The FIAV is used during cold start ups, it's personal preference whether you want to use it or not. To wire the TPS you will need a TPS connector from a 91-up car, then it's simply wire for wire, they are the same colors.
